Power Outages Across Sri Lanka Amid Strong Winds and Adverse Weather

The Ceylon Electricity Board (CEB) has reported widespread power outages across multiple regions in Sri Lanka following strong gusty winds that swept through Colombo and other parts of the country on Thursday night. According to the CEB, a total of 29,015 electricity breakdowns have been recorded nationwide as a result of the prevailing adverse weather conditions.

CEB Media Spokesman Dhammika Wimalaratne stated that repair teams have been deployed to the affected areas in order to restore electricity as quickly as possible. The CEB has also urged the public to report any ongoing power outages through the dedicated ‘1987’ hotline or the ‘CEBCare’ mobile application for prompt assistance.
